The linear function that can be used to determine the height, H, of the plane after m minutes is given by:
H(m) = 8000 - 500m
<h3>What is a linear function?</h3>
A linear function is modeled by:
In which:
- m is the slope, which is the rate of change, that is, by how much y changes when x changes by 1.
- b is the y-intercept, which is the value of y when x = 0, and can also be interpreted as the initial value.
In this problem:
- The plane is descending from an altitude of 8,000 feet, hence the y-intercept is b = 8000.
- The plane descends at a constant rate of 500 feet per minute, hence the slope is of m = -500.
Thus, the equation is:
H(m) = 8000 - 500m.
